Just had to comment about your comment below -- if you go on ANY diet and lose weight 
and then go off that diet and go back to what you were doing before (the same eating 
habits that caused you to gain in the first place) -- you WILL gain the weight back 
and probably more than you lost. Doesn't matter if it's low carb, low fat, low 
calorie or even NoS. Whatever you find that works for you to lose weight, you have to 
also figure out how to maintain that loss. I know for me -- I have lost weight many, 
many times. I go ON a diet, lose weight and the go OFF the diet. What happens when I 
go OFF the diet? I go back to eating the way I used to and gain it all back -- and 
very quickly, I might add. The beauty of NoS is that it is really teaching us how to 
maintain -- losing weight is really the wonderful side effect.
